Transaction e21c9432446e7252133b83efd39eb50e937fdc297e5d2d54636c3b00daf96b99
1 Input
1 Output
-
e21c9432446e7252133b83efd39eb50e937fdc297e5d2d54636c3b00daf96b99:0
- value
- 677861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1612132a158ef7be47fbde8de8e3f223c299c1f OP_EQUAL
- address
- 3HrutBkQdwfH4M7ykMLtp4WNHKruUvK1Nv